The ACER Scholarship exam is used by many Australian schools to award academic scholarships, sat by students entering Years 5 through 10. Primary applies to students entering Years 5-6 and is tested as Reading and Viewing, Mathematics, and Writing. Secondary applies to students entering Years 7-10 and is tested as Humanities, Mathematics, and Writing Expression.
